Does Africa still have solar power?

While the spread of solar energy across Africa is encouraging, a significant concentration of capacity persists. In 2024, 78 per cent of all new installations were concentrated in just two countries — South Africa and Egypt.

Is South Africa a good country for solar energy?

South Africa has developed several solar thermal plants, both parabolic trough and power tower types. In 2017, it was the leading country in Africa for both solar thermal and PV solar energy. ^ a b "Global Solar Atlas".

Which African countries rely on solar energy?

Many perpetually sunny African nations like Egypt, Libya, Algeria, Niger, Sudan, South Africa, Botswana and Namibia for instance could rely on developing their tremendous solar resources on a large scale thanks to the immense surface of their territory and at reduced prices.

How many solar power plants are there in South Africa?

By 2023, South Africa had installed 500 MW in concentrated solar power, 2286 MW in utility scale solar, and 4400 MW in rooftop solar. Several 75 MW PV plants and 2 CSP plants at 100 MW each were the largest in the country and among the largest in Africa.

Africa is often considered and referred as the "Sun continent" or the continent where the Sun''s influence is the greatest. According to the "World Sunshine Map", Africa receives many more hours of bright sunshine during the course of the year than any other continent of the Earth: and many of the sunniest countries on the planet are in Africa.
